Description
The Cross Armory Extended Slide Lock features an extended design. The Cross Extended Slide Lock is made from 4140 Ordnance steel and carefully surface treated for corrosion resistance. Cross Armory has improved the geometry to make the install time minimal, finger response optimal, with increased strength and reliability
